Peaceful Way wins the 2005 Breeders Crown Open Mare Trot

Breeders Crown 2005 Mare Trotphoto by Terence Dulay
The Breeders Crown action kicked off on Saturday night with the $250,000 Open Mare Trot. Peaceful Way was bet down to 2-5 favoritism over 5-2 Housethatruthbuilt. Driver Trevor Ritchie settled Peaceful Way back in fourth for the backstretch trip, as 8-1 third choice Windylane Hanover led the field through a half in :56, with Housethatruthbuilt 1 3/4 lengths behind in second. On the turn, Ritchie asked Peaceful Way for her rally and got it, as the favorite powered away to a 2-length lead with a furlong to go. 25-1 longshot Mystical Sunshine made a valiant rally from eighth but was no match for the favorite, as Peaceful Way hit the line 1 1/4 lengths clear in a time of 1:53.1. It was 1/4 length back from Mystical Sunshine to Housethatruthbuilt in third, and 6 more to Windylane Hanover in fourth.

Trainer Dave Tingley said, "She answered the critics here in a big way, silencing them. This is probably the most nervous I've been watching her race, just because the race has eluded us for two years in a row. She's a great horse and just an amazing mare." Driver Trevor Ritchie said, "Once we settled down I moved her down the backstretch, we began to roll. She's not a one-trip pony, she can be very handy. She started to ease up a little in the lane but if there had been another horse coming and she heard or saw it, she would have been stronger. She's a very smart horse"
